Description of problem:
I have a mixed cluster in RHEV 3.4: with one RHEL 7.0 host and one RHEL 6.5 host. After dealing with some VM disks, the VMs can't start on RHEL 6.5 host anymore because the disk images were upgraded to incompatible version:
2014-11-28T13:53:40.199311Z qemu-kvm: -drive <options>: 'drive-virtio-disk0' uses a qcow2 feature which is not supported by this qemu version: QCOW version 3

RHEV should instruct RHEL 7 hosts not to use such features unless some RHEL 7-only cluster level is chosen (not available yet)

How reproducible:
always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. create a new VM disk using rhel7 SPM host
2. try to start the VM on rhel6 host
3.

Actual results:
VM can't start with error above

Expected results:
VMs are backwards-compatible
